Physical Health and Fitness

One of the most immediate benefits of karate is improved physical health. Youth who practice karate regularly develop strength, flexibility, and coordination. Karate training involves a combination of cardiovascular exercises and muscle conditioning. This helps children maintain a healthy weight, improve posture, and increase overall stamina. In addition, karate encourages a disciplined approach to physical activity, fostering habits that contribute to long-term health.

Mental Discipline and Focus

Karate teaches more than just physical techniques. It emphasizes mental discipline, focus, and self-control. Young students learn to concentrate on tasks, follow instructions, and maintain composure in challenging situations. These skills translate into academic and social success, helping children stay attentive in school and develop strong problem-solving abilities. Confidence and Self-Esteem

Confidence is a key outcome of consistent karate practice. As children master new techniques and earn higher belt rankings, they gain a sense of achievement that boosts self-esteem. Karate also teaches young people to handle failure gracefully. Learning to overcome challenges in training instills courage and perseverance. These qualities are invaluable in building confident individuals who are prepared to face obstacles both inside and outside the dojo.

Social Skills and Community

Karate classes provide a safe and structured environment where youth can interact with peers who share similar goals. Group training sessions promote teamwork, respect, and effective communication. Children learn to support one another while respecting individual differences. This sense of community helps prevent negative influences and fosters strong social bonds. Character Development and Responsibility

Beyond physical and mental benefits, karate instills core values such as respect, discipline, and responsibility. Students learn the importance of following rules, respecting instructors, and taking accountability for their actions. These lessons contribute to overall character development and help youth become responsible citizens.
